Omron HR-100C Heart Rate Monitor Knowing your heart rate is important because if you are working out too hard, your activity can become counter productive and strain muscles. To achieve an effective workout, no matter what the aerobic activity, you must maintain your heart rate at a proper level for a minimum of 20 minutes. Strengths: accuracy
Weakness: manual explanation
The equipment manual does not tell but you have to put the belt very close to heart for the equipment to detect the heart beats. Otherwise it is a very accurate one, which is designed very well for aiding in exercising.

Strengths: Inexpensive, includes clock/timer, comfortable, easy to change battery
Weakness: Needs a lot of moisture to get readings, seems to be inaccurate
Very inexpensive heart rate monitor. The watch includes a clock and timer, and can be set to indicate when your heart rate is in the optimal range. The monitor sits below your chest and is pretty comfortable and readily adjustable. In addition, the battery on the belt monitor can be changed by the user.
